4. What You Should NOT Sell on Amazon (High-Risk Products)
Restricted and Gated Categories
When deciding what to sell on Amazon, avoid restricted categories such as health supplements, luxury watches, and branded electronics, which require approval and pose compliance risks.
Products with High Return Rates or Thin Profit Margins
Avoid products prone to frequent returns, including clothing (due to sizing issues), fragile items, and low-margin goods. High return rates reduce profitability and impact seller ratings.
Legal and Compliance Issues
Selling counterfeit, trademarked, or unsafe products can lead to account suspension. Always verify supplier credibility and ensure compliance with Amazon’s safety regulations before listing products.

Understanding Sales Rank and Competition Levels
A product’s Best Sellers Rank (BSR) indicates its demand. Low BSR means high sales, but too much competition can make it difficult to rank. Look for high-demand, low-competition products for better profit potential.

Retail Arbitrage, Online Arbitrage, and Wholesale
Retail Arbitrage: Buying discounted products from retail stores (Walmart, Target) and reselling on Amazon. Low startup costs but limited scalability.
Online Arbitrage: Purchasing discounted products from online marketplaces and flipping them on Amazon. Requires pricing research and inventory tracking.
Wholesale: Buying bulk inventory from distributors at lower costs, ideal for scaling, but may require brand approval.

Q. How can I price my products competitively without losing profit?
A. To price effectively, use Amazon’s FBA fee calculator to estimate costs and ensure at least a 30% profit margin. Utilize dynamic repricing tools to stay competitive and consider bundling products to increase perceived value while differentiating from competitors.
